The LED’s indicate if the translator is speaking to the devices on the network. The LED’s should reflect
communication traffic based on the baud rate set. The higher the baud rate the LED’s would become
more solid.
LEDs
Status
Power
Lights when power is being supplied to the translator.
The XPC is protected by internal solid state Polyswitches on the
incoming power and network connections. These Polyswitches
are not replaceable and will reset themselves if the condition that
caused the fault returns to normal.
Rx
Lights when the translator receives data from the network
segment; there is an Rx LED for Ports 1 and 2.
Tx
Lights when the translator transits data from the network
segment; there is an Rx LED for Ports 1 and 2.
Run
Lights based on translator health. See table below.
Error
Lights based on translator health. See table below.
The Run and Error LED's indicate translator and network status.
